Is Northern Mistake Worth Watching? Honest Movie Review & Audience Verdict (1990)

The film is set in 1944, when Bulgaria was an ally of Nazi Germany. The story follows a group of Bulgarian officers who are captured by the Soviet army during World War II. They are sent to a camp where they try to survive and maintain their dignity despite the harsh conditions and political situation.
